wires

UK //ˈwaɪəz//US //ˈwaɪərz//

词源

源自古英语wīr(金属丝),与古诺尔斯语vīrr(细金属)同源,可能最终源自原始印欧语*wei-(弯曲/缠绕)。动词用法始见于15世纪,电子汇款义项出现于19世纪电报时代。

noun

❶ 指金属制成的细长导线,通常用于传输电力或信号。可以是单根或多根组合,常见于电器、建筑等场景。

“The electrician is checking the wires behind the wall.”

(电工正在检查墙后的电线。)

“Be careful not to touch the exposed wires.”

(小心不要碰到裸露的电线。)

❶ 在非正式语境中可指秘密监听设备或隐藏的通讯装置,常用于间谍或警匪题材。

“The detective planted wires to record their conversation.”

(侦探安装了窃听器来录制他们的谈话。)

“She suspected her phone had a wire when she heard static noises.”

(当她听到静电噪音时,怀疑手机被装了窃听器。)

同义词:cables, conductors, lines

verb

❶ 用导线连接或安装电子设备,强调物理接线的动作过程。

“He wired the speakers to the amplifier correctly.”

(他正确地将扬声器连接到放大器。)

“We need to wire the new security system before tomorrow.”

(我们需要在明天之前接好新的安全系统线路。)

❶ 通过电子方式汇款,尤指跨国快速转账的金融操作。

“I'll wire the payment to your account this afternoon.”

(我今天下午会把款项汇到你的账户。)

“Emergency funds were wired to the disaster area immediately.”

(紧急资金立即电汇到了灾区。)

同义词:connect, transfer, send

常见短语

down to the wire — 形容事情直到最后期限或最后一刻才完成,强调时间紧迫和结果不确定的状态。

“The election results came down to the wire with only a few votes difference.”

(选举结果直到最后一刻才揭晓,仅以几票之差定胜负。)

under the wire — 指在截止时间前勉强完成某事,常带有惊险或侥幸完成的意味。

“She submitted her thesis under the wire, just minutes before the deadline.”

(她在截止时间前几分钟惊险地提交了论文。)
